Low-emissivity glass
Low-emissivity glass can be used to double-glaze. It is an energy efficient type of double glazing. It is transparent glass with an oxide-coated metallic layer inside. The oxide is a barrier to the longer wavelength rays of the sun which allows more sunlight to be reflected through the glass. The low-e coating helps keep the interior of the home warm in warmer months by preventing heat from escaping.
While many believe that Low-E glass is more expensive than regular glass however, the reality is that it can be a very affordable upgrade to your home. It can dramatically enhance the lighting in your home, and it can also help you save money on cooling or heating.
The ability to limit condensation which is a frequent reason for the growth of mould in the home, is an additional benefit. This is due to the low-e coating is effective in keeping the condensation from accumulating. Condensation could cause rot which can affect the property's value as well as its health.

Casement windows
If you're planning to replace or renovate your windows, the casement windows have many advantages. They offer ease of using, a large window opening and natural cooling. They are durable and easy-to-maintenance.
Casement windows can be hung permanently to an interior wall. They can be opened either left or right, and are secured by a ratcheting crank. When closed, the sash is pushed against the frame, forming an airtight seal. This improves insulation and lowers cooling costs.

Secondary glazing

There are a variety of options for secondary glazing, such as vertical sliding sashes as well as side-hung casements. Sliding sash windows can be good for fixed windows, like French doors. They also work well for regular ventilation.
Magnetic secondary glazing is a simple and affordable way to improve the insulation value of your home. It is made up of a secondary panel that is attached to the existing window frame using magnetic seals. It is lightweight and easy to remove.
Secondary glazing can increase the sound insulation of your house. This is particularly beneficial in older homes where noise from nearby buildings can be a concern. These types of windows can also help lower the U-value of the primary window.
